Unusual Noises



If your heat pump is making uncommon sounds, it could be an indication that something is amiss. Normally, a well-functioning heatpump ought to run quietly, so any kind of weird sounds can indicate a problem.

One common sound to listen for is a grinding or screeching audio, which may recommend that there are concerns with the motor bearings or belt. If you listen to rattling or vibrating sounds, it could be as a result of loosened elements within the unit that need tightening up.

Hissing sounds might indicate a cooling agent leakage, which is a major issue that requires instant focus from an expert technician. Popping or banging noises could be a sign of dirty or blocked ductwork, causing air flow limitations.

Increased Power Expenses



During the peak cold weather, you might have discovered a considerable surge in your home energy costs. If your heatpump isn't working efficiently, maybe the wrongdoer behind these intensifying expenses. When a heatpump needs fixing, it commonly works more difficult to keep the preferred temperature in your home, causing boosted power intake and higher costs.

One typical factor for enhanced energy expenses is a filthy or blocked filter in your heat pump system. A filthy filter restricts air flow, causing your heat pump to work more challenging and use even more power to warm or cool your home properly.

Furthermore, cooling agent leaks, faulty components, or an aging system can all contribute to lowered performance and higher energy use.
